Oneida Baptist Institute
Independent Christian Boarding School
Oneida Baptist Institute is a historic Christian boarding and day school located approximately 35 miles from Waneta. Serving students in grades 6-12, OBI combines rigorous academic preparation with character development in a supportive community environment. The school offers comprehensive college preparatory curriculum alongside practical vocational training in areas like automotive technology, agriculture, and computer science. With a beautiful 160-acre campus in the Appalachian foothills, the school provides modern academic facilities, dormitories, and extensive athletic programs. The school maintains a strong academic reputation with personalized attention and a family-like atmosphere that has served generations of Appalachian students.
